Set against a deep burgundy backdrop with soft, directional shadows, the composition features a dark glass jar of Yelli Aroma Tomato sauce resting on a stepped geometric plinth. The packaging employs a stark black label with bold white and red typography, displaying Cyrillic text that identifies the product as a wine accompaniment made from sun-dried tomatoes and Parmesan. To the left, a circular lid graphic mirrors the jar's color palette, while the foreground showcases an open-faced tartine topped with the chunky red spread, fresh herbs, and a delicate onion garnish, all positioned beside a stemmed glass of dark red wine.

Visual interest derives from the sophisticated interplay between the matte black labeling and the vibrant red accents, which create a high-contrast aesthetic suited for premium positioning. The arrangement deliberately balances the commercial product with its culinary application, using scattered cashews and a floating onion slice to add organic texture to the otherwise rigid geometric staging. Lighting is carefully controlled to emphasize the glossy surface of the wine glass and the rich texture of the sauce, establishing a moody, aspirational atmosphere that elevates a standard condiment into a gourmet experience.
